newer batch of grado. has different soldering temperature as older one.
old one can take up to 350C. but new one. pls set the temperature to less than 280C. else u might burn the voice coil. especially some that they originally solder badly. that the cable is soldered with big dump of lead. and the lead is directly heating up the voice coil when u attempt to change wire. set ur temperature lower, and work faster when u heat them up. it shall be fine. make sure you know what u wanna do when u touch ur soldering gun on the lead. don't heat up only u consider what's next. |

Added on October 2, 2010, 3:50 am QUOTE(Yuki Ijuin @ Oct 2 2010, 03:31 AM) Eh. My SR60s right side slipped off the metal thingy too. yeah.. can do like thatHere's what I did. I heated up the metal thingy and wobbled it back into the slot melting a little bit of plastic to keep it in place, works like a charm. :3 but.. if more than 1 times. don't do this methods. as it will makes the holes bigger and bigger. usually i will ask people to get CLEAR EPOXY (usually i use Bostik Brand) available in most jusco. comes in small tubes, and very cheap. take the one with 5 tonnes capability. then put a bit in the holes wait for 24 hours until it's totaly dry. i do fix quite a numbers of grado headphone with that. even those sending in for recable and has potential of loosen.. i oso help apply a bit on it. =) This post has been edited by PcWork: Oct 2 2010, 03:50 AM |

QUOTE(power911 @ Oct 2 2010, 03:44 PM) i forgotten it is 5 min epoxy or not.but i am sure it is CLEAR epoxy. if u can find Clear epoxy which settle within 5 minutes, can get that. and.. despite it is 5 minute epoxy, it still have to settle for 24 hours for maximum strength. just that after 5 minutes, it's kinda sticky so that the parts can hold themself up. don't get STEEL epoxy. as it will has some grey powder formed when it dry. and it doesnt really hold plastic that strong.. i tried. don't work. clear epoxy on the other hand. works charmingly. the clear epoxy. is ... clear.. transparent colour.. with very very slight yellowish tint. |

all factory terminated CABLES for audio, as long as it is not super cheap type, it will be TERMINATED BY HAND. so the question of hand made VS factory made is not even exits. since 99.9% cable out there WERE hand terminated for more reliability even though they are named as "original Factory Terminated" take cardas cable for example. each and single of the cable has the personnel's signature on the cable as well as the certificates of it.
